What Did the NHTSA Find in Their Investigation?
The NHTSA’s investigation into the Missouri rear-end collision uncovered several key factors contributing to the accident. Driver distraction was identified as a pivotal element, potentially exacerbated by high traffic density at the time of the crash. In terms of vehicle safety features, the investigation found that while both vehicles were equipped with standard safety systems, the effectiveness of airbags and anti-lock braking systems (ABS) varied, with the SUV’s systems not engaging as effectively as expected. Weather conditions were clear, ruling out external environmental factors as contributors to the crash.
For those following similar occurrences, understanding these contributing factors can guide future preventive measures. How Did Vehicle Technologies Perform in This Crash?
The vehicles involved in the Missouri rear-end collision were equipped with several safety technologies designed to mitigate crash severity. This included anti-lock brakes, traction control, and advanced airbag systems. Comparing the performance of these technologies to industry standards, the investigation revealed a disparity in efficacy. Specifically, the SUV’s braking system did not perform optimally, a factor that may have contributed to the failure to prevent the crash.
While these technologies are generally effective, their limitations underscore the importance of regular vehicle maintenance and updates. What Safety Takeaways Can Drivers Learn?
The findings from the NHTSA report highlight several safety takeaways for drivers. Maintaining safe following distances is critical to allowing sufficient reaction time and reducing collision risk. Additionally, while advanced driver-assistance systems (ADAS) like automatic emergency braking can aid in accident prevention, they are complements to, not replacements for, vigilant driving practices. Enhancing driver awareness, through education on safe driving strategies and defensive driving courses, is vital for improving reaction times and overall road safety.

What Steps Should You Take After a Crash?
Being involved in a crash can be a disorienting experience, but following a series of clear steps can ensure safety and proper documentation. First, ensure personal safety by moving to a safe location and contacting authorities for assistance. Exchange contact and insurance information with other parties involved. Document the scene with photographs, noting vehicle positions, damages, and any relevant road conditions. Contacting your insurance provider promptly is crucial for initiating claims.
